This change ensures that we include as a parent to the initial commit
of a patch COB, the head of the branch we are proposing as a patch.
This was already happening for patch updates, but we forgot to also
include it for the initial patch revision.
This ensures that the code is always fetched alongside the patch.

By introducing a small limitation: only allowing entries in the change
graph to be addressable, instead of individual operations; we
drastically simplify the CRDT implementation.
There are four advantages:
1. Op ids are just regular SHA-1s
2. There's no need for relative IDs, ops never refer to other ops within the
same commit
3. There's no need for a nonce, since commits can't collide, and neither can op IDs
4. `OpId` can just be an alias of `EntryId`
The disadvantage of course, is that we have to be mindful of how we
create op transactions, since each transaction creates an addressable
unit. For example, we must not include multiple patch revisions in the
same transaction.

The olpc-json crate's CanonicalFormatter does not escape certain
control characters, including new lines. This means that when a COB
gets serialized that includes new lines, those new lines are
serialized verbatim. Upon deserialization `serde_json` -- and any
other JSON deserializer -- will fail due to the encounter of these
control characters.
This behaviour was prevented in radicle-link with the definition of
its own CanoncialFormatter that encodes the control characters
correctly.
Inline this definition of the formatter, under MIT license, to ensure
the correct and remove oplc-cjson.
The behaviour is checked using a multiline test in the issue COB.

Sometimes it is more efficient to perform multiple operations at once
and store those in the collaborative object graph together.
Change the contents to be a non-empty sequence of byte sequences,
i.e. NonEmpty<Vec<u8>>. These are stored as blobs in a git tree in
order by their index in the non-empty sequence. They are, in turn,
retrieved in order of their original index.
Change the conversion of an `EntryWithClock` to return a non-empty
sequence of `Op`s, which are in turn used to apply many changes in
each `from_history` implementation.
